Pet door installation services involve fitting a specially designed door or flap into an existing exterior door, wall, or window to allow pets to move freely between indoor and outdoor spaces. This process typically includes measuring the pet, selecting the appropriate door size, and securely installing the unit to ensure durability and proper function. Skilled contractors handle the work carefully to minimize damage to the property and ensure a seamless fit that blends with the existing structure. Whether for small cats or larger dogs, professional installation helps ensure the pet door operates smoothly and remains secure over time.
Many pet owners seek installation services to address common problems such as restricted access, inconvenience, or safety concerns. Without a pet door, owners may need to open doors repeatedly or worry about pets wandering outside unsupervised. Installing a pet door provides pets with independent access to yard or garden areas, reducing stress for both animals and owners. It can also prevent pets from scratching or damaging doors in their attempts to go outside, and help keep pets safe by allowing quick escape in emergencies or adverse weather conditions.

The overview below groups typical Pet Door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or pet door repairs or adjustments typically cost between $50 and $150, depending on the specific issue. Many routine fixes fall within this range, making them an affordable option for quick improvements.
Standard Installation - Installing a new pet door into a standard door or wall usually ranges from $150 to $300. Most local contractors handle these projects efficiently within this typical price band.
Full Replacement - Replacing an existing pet door or installing a larger or more complex model can cost between $300 and $600. Larger or custom installations tend to push costs higher, but many projects stay within this range.
Large or Complex Projects - Custom or multi-door installations, or those involving structural modifications, can reach $1,000 or more. These higher-end projects are less common but are handled by specialized local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of pet doors can local contractors install? Local contractors can install a variety of pet doors, including manual, electronic, and magnetic options, to suit different pet sizes and homeowner preferences.
Are pet door installations suitable for all door types? Many local service providers are experienced in installing pet doors in various door materials such as wood, metal, and vinyl, ensuring compatibility and proper fitting.
What should I consider before choosing a pet door installation? It’s important to consider the size of your pet, the location of the door, and the type of pet door that best fits your needs, which local pros can help determine.
Can pet door installation be done in both interior and exterior doors? Yes, local contractors can install pet doors in both interior and exterior doors, as well as in walls or windows if needed.
How do local service providers ensure a secure pet door installation? They use appropriate tools and techniques to ensure the pet door is properly fitted, secure, and functions correctly to prevent drafts or security issues.
